Output 66910fb3c0e2cae1faa66dd80d1ee6f23ebb9a715883e9c15128cb8d4a37b299:0

value
1720925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c999aea87480aebfd4f946e83c8a67dea8288d7a OP_EQUAL
address
3L4yr8co7LCg3oa1hxYUWMTe36Eso7bq8g
transaction
66910fb3c0e2cae1faa66dd80d1ee6f23ebb9a715883e9c15128cb8d4a37b299
confirmations
279114
spent
true